Characteristics of RO Membrane

  R/O Membrane Filter eliminates all pollutants such as heavy metals, virus, bacteria and organic chemicals through stomata with the size of 0.0001 μm , which is 1/1,000,000 of the thickness of human hair.
  R/O Membrane separates organic chemicals better than inorganic chemicals and electrolytes better than non-electrolytes. R/O Membrane can eliminate not only the substances of particle nature but also the substances of ionic nature, the particle size of which is very small.
  R/O Membrane separates substances without changing the phase of the substances and is applicable to various fields as it has good physical and chemical durability.

Reverse Osmosis Phenomena

When solutions which have differences in concentration is separated by semi-permeable membrane, the water solution with low concentration moves toward high concentration side after lapse of certain time making difference in water level which is called osmosis phenomena.The difference in water level generated at that time is called osmotic pressure while water solution with high concentration moves toward low concentration side if pressure that is higher than osmotic pressure is given to the solution with high concentration, which is called Reverse Osmosis phenomena.

Effect of pressure

Feedwater pressure affects both the water flux and salt rejection of RO membranes. Osmosis is the flow of water across a membrane from the dilute side toward the concentrated solution side.
Reverse osmosis technology involves application of pressure to the feedwater stream to overcome the natural osmotic pressure. Pressure in excess of the osmotic pressure is applied to the concentrated solution and the flow of water is reversed. A portion of the feedwater (concentrated solution) is forced through the membrane to emerge as purified product water of the dilute solution side ( please see Figure 1).

Figure 1. Overview of Osmosis / Reverse Osmosis



Effect of recovery

As shown in Figure 1, reverse osmosis occurs when the natural osmotic flow between a dilute solution and a concentrated solution is reversed through application of feedwater pressure. If percentage recovery is increased (and feedwater pressure remains constant),the salts in the residual feed become more concentrated and the natural osmotic pressure will increase until it is as high as the applied feed pressure.
This can negate the driving effect of feed pressure slowing or halting the reverse osmosis process and causing permeate flux and salt rejection to decrease and even stop.

General information

  The first full tank of permeate should be discarded. Do not use this initial permeate for drinking water or food preparation.
  Keep elements moist at all times after initial wetting.
  If operation limits and guidelines given in this bulletin are not strictly followed, the limited warranty will be null and void.
  To prevent biological growth during prolonged system shutdowns, it is recommended that membrane elements be immersed in a preservative solution.
  The membrane shows some resistance to short-term attack by chlorine ( hypochlorite) Continuous exposure, however, may damage the membrane and should be avoided.
  The customer is fully responsible for the effects of incompatible chemicals and lubricants on elements. Their use will void the element limited warranty.
